LAVA Therapeutics Announces Collaboration with Merck to Evaluate LAVA-1207 in Combination with KEYTRUDA
“We are excited to work with Merck & Co., Inc., Rahway, NJ, USA as we continue to unlock the therapeutic potential of LAVA-1207 and explore its potential capabilities in combination with KEYTRUDA®,” said Stephen Hurly, President and Chief Executive Officer, LAVA. “To date, LAVA-1207 has demonstrated a favorable safety profile and shown preliminary signs of anti-tumor activity. Prostate cancer has presented challenges for immune checkpoint therapies in the past – we are hopeful the combination of our products may deliver important clinical outcomes.”
